    How Gunmen Abducted Benue Information Commissioner

    In a daring attack, gunmen on Sunday night invaded the residence of Benue State Commissioner of Information, Culture and Tourism, Matthew Abo, and kidnapped him.

    Abo was whisked away at 8:00 pm after the assailants stormed his country home in Zaki Bian, Ukum Local Government Area of the state.

    The information commissioner was at home with his family members when the gunmen came on four motorcycles and found their way into his living room.

    “The kidnappers came on four motorcycles, ordered everyone in the house including the commissioner’s wife and children to lie face down, and took him away to an unknown destination on one of the motorcycles.

    “The abductors forced the commissioner to sit behind the rider of one of the motorcycles while a gunman sandwiched him,” an eyewitness said.

    Abo was among the 17 commissioners sworn in on August 29, 2023, by Governor Hyacinth Alia.

    The incident has been confirmed by the Chief Press Secretary to the governor, Kula Tersoo.

    Tersoo said, “Yes he was kidnapped. Unfortunately, he was kidnapped in his country home in Ukum LGA, around 8 pm on, Sunday, September 24, 2023.

    “He was home with his family, children, and his people when the armed men came in. They forced him to a bike.

    “We received the unfortunate development and His Excellency, Governor Hyacinth Alia has already directed and detailed the security operatives to ensure his safe release from the kidnappers’ den.”
